Sustainable Packaging Solutions

Sustainability is more than a trend, it is a mandate for the best business ideas for 2026. The global sustainable packaging market is projected to reach $470 billion by 2026, driven by consumer demand and regulatory requirements. Key innovations include biodegradable materials, reusable packaging, and circular economy integration.

These solutions not only reduce waste but also lower carbon footprints and help brands meet strict environmental standards. Startups, manufacturers, and e-commerce retailers are especially well positioned to benefit. While initial R&D investment and supply chain adjustments are needed, the payoff comes from strong B2B partnerships and a loyal, eco-conscious customer base.

For example, Loop has revolutionized packaging by offering reusable containers for major brands, setting a new industry standard. As more companies seek to align with environmental goals, sustainable packaging will remain at the forefront of the best business ideas for 2026.

AI-Driven Healthcare Platforms

AI-driven healthcare is transforming patient care and stands out among the best business ideas for 2026. The AI healthcare market is expected to hit $45.2 billion by 2026, thanks to advancements in remote diagnostics, AI-powered triage, and personalized treatment plans.

These platforms increase accessibility, reduce costs, and improve outcomes by leveraging data and automation. Clinics, hospitals, and telehealth providers can offer smarter, more efficient services. The scalability of digital health solutions ensures recurring revenue streams, though entrepreneurs must address regulatory and data privacy concerns.

Babylon Health, for example, provides AI-powered consultations that deliver fast, reliable health advice. As technology evolves, AI-driven healthcare will play a pivotal role in shaping the best business ideas for 2026.

Vertical Farming and Urban Agriculture

Urbanization and sustainability concerns are pushing vertical farming and urban agriculture into the spotlight as best business ideas for 2026. The market is set to reach $24 billion by 2026, driven by hydroponics, aeroponics, and IoT-enabled monitoring.

These systems reduce food miles, enable year-round production, and use land efficiently. Urban entrepreneurs, agri-tech firms, and grocers are among those best positioned to capitalize. Although setup costs and energy use are considerations, the benefits for city environments are profound.

AeroFarms’ large-scale indoor farms demonstrate how vertical farming can revolutionize food production. This approach will remain critical among the best business ideas for 2026, meeting both sustainability and food security needs.

Decentralized Finance (DeFi) Services

Decentralized finance is ushering in a new era of financial inclusion, ranking it among the best business ideas for 2026. The DeFi market is projected to surpass $232 billion by 2026, with peer-to-peer lending, crypto wallets, and smart contracts driving innovation.

These services offer lower fees, transparency, and global accessibility. Fintech startups, investors, and underbanked populations are key beneficiaries. Despite regulatory uncertainty and security risks, rapid innovation and worldwide reach make DeFi a compelling opportunity.

Compound’s decentralized lending protocol shows how DeFi can disrupt traditional finance. As blockchain adoption grows, DeFi solutions will remain vital among the best business ideas for 2026.

Step-by-Step Validation Process

To bring the best business ideas for 2026 to life, start with clear market research. Identify your target audience, analyze competitors, and map out pain points. Next, build a minimum viable product (MVP) — a simple version of your solution that addresses the core problem.

Gather feedback early from potential customers through interviews, surveys, and prototype testing. Use this input to refine your offering, focusing on product-market fit. Implement feedback loops, allowing you to iterate quickly and improve based on real user data. This approach helps avoid the common pitfall of launching without clear demand, which accounts for 42% of startup failures according to CB Insights.
